Rockland Public Library celebrates Library Card Registration Month

ROCKLAND – Celebrate Library Card Sign-Up Month this September at the Rockland Public Library. The library invites everyone to discover or rediscover the resources and opportunities available to the public by signing up for a library card.

“The Rockland Public Library is a treasure trove of information and more than just books,” RPL said in a press release.

The library offers a wide variety of public programs, book clubs for adults and teens, story times for children, author talks, musical performances and more.

“A library card is not required for browsing, programs, and events. However, it is required to borrow from our fantastic collection of print books, as well as thousands of audiobooks and e-books (and more) courtesy of Hoopla and the CloudLibrary,” RPL said.

Want to try a new hobby or learn a new language? According to the press release, RPL has the resources you need, including a weekly French group. Need help with a school project or have a technical question? Book one of the librarians to help you. Want to get out and have a chat? Join the Wednesday Walkers, get some exercise, enjoy the fresh air and make new friends.

When you sign up for a library card in September, you’ll automatically be entered into a drawing to win a fantastic prize. If current cardholders bring a friend to apply for a new card, they’ll be entered into the drawing. Patrons with expired cards can renew their account and will also be entered into the drawing. Winners will be randomly selected on September 30th.

People who live or own property in the City of Rockland, as well as members of the Coast Guard stationed in Rockland, are eligible for a free card. Thanks to the Friends of Rockland Public Library, children and teachers in Knox County through 12th grade are also eligible for a free card.

Non-residents pay an annual fee of $45 (for an individual or family card), and there is a short-term 3-month membership for $25. Please bring a photo ID and proof of your current physical address (bill, checkbook, lease, etc.) to obtain a library card.
